How many players and balls are in professional dodgeball?

1. Maximum of 6 players and a minimum of 2 females (one of which must be from the team’s roster) on each team at the start of the game. 2. 6 standard IDA-approved balls (8.25” foam balls) are placed on the centerline in two groups of 3.

How many players are there in dodgeball?

Teams will be made up of 6-10 players. Six (6) players will compete on a side; others will be available as substitutes. Substitutes may enter the game if a ball is caught and there are less than six of their teammates on the court.

How many balls are used in the official game of dodgeball?

6 balls will be used. The official will place 3 balls at the off-sides/center line for each team. Players must start behind their own baseline before the start of play. Anyone can possess and throw any of the six balls that are in play.

How many players are on a team in the most common game of dodgeball?

Teams can have more than 8 players on a team. The team can start with a maximum of 8 people (1 woman minimum) on the court and the rest can start in the jail. At no point in the game may a team have more than 8 people on the court. A match consists of a 9 games.

How long can you hold the ball in dodgeball?

No player can hold the ball for longer than 5 seconds. Penalty- roll the ball gently to the other team. The opposing team is responsible for calling the stall count.

Can you make money playing dodgeball?

“The money is great, so it kind of validates that it’s becoming a real sport,” says one player. A recent championship in Las Vegas had a $20,000 prize; over a two-year period, one top team reports winning $100,000.

What ball is used in dodgeball?

Art. 1 The official ball used in tournament and league play will be an 8-inch rubber coated ball. Art. 2 The standard number of balls for a 12-player game is six on a side.
